If you have bought Microsoft Word or Office, then you have access to a huge set of online clip art, all searchable, and AFAICT, the license agreement on Microsoft's website says it's OK to use them in your programs, just as long as the program isn't a clip art program.

The EULA on the website is in fact more liberal than the one displayed by the Microsoft Clip Art utility that comes with Office.

All the clip art images are vector-based. I used GraphicConverter on the Mac to make them huge bitmaps, made them transparent and masked, then reduced them to the size I needed (with nice 8-bit masks). Simple, fast, and decent results.
